6326a2786a1ba011dcf1bc900ca501479f4324c8ed6ecf3210a7076adf7942e4

1913447 (21239 blocks ago)

368235129

⏴ Block 1913446 (f5752c90...17c) | Block 1913448 ⏵ | Latest block ⏭

Metadata

14/8/25, 5:36 am UTC (29d 11:58:52 ago) 22.1 555B (555B block + 0B txs) Pulse 💓 34.9062 SENT

Transactions (0)

Show raw details